Understanding Austin’s Waste Disposal Laws
First, a crucial warning: simply dumping your trash on public property, in a commercial dumpster that isn’t yours, or on the side of the road is illegal. The City of Austin and the State of Texas take illegal dumping seriously, and the consequences can be severe.
According to the Texas Health and Safety Code, Section 365.012, offenders can face significant fines and even jail time. The penalties are tiered based on the amount and type of waste, escalating from a misdemeanor to a state jail felony. The property owner can also be held responsible for cleanup costs, even if they weren’t the one who dumped the waste.
To avoid any legal trouble, it’s essential to use an approved disposal site. Here’s a quick look at the potential penalties you could face for illegal dumping in Texas.
| Offense Class | Weight / Volume Threshold | Commercial Purpose Threshold | Potential Penalties |
| Class C Misdemeanor | 5 lbs or less | N/A | Fine up to $500 |
| Class B Misdemeanor | More than 5 lbs but less than 500 lbs | N/A | Up to 180 days in jail and/or a fine up to $2,000 |
| Class A Misdemeanor | 500 lbs to less than 1,000 lbs | More than 5 lbs but less than 200 lbs | Up to 1 year in jail and/or a fine up to $4,000 |
| State Jail Felony | 1,000 lbs or more | 200 lbs or more | Up to 2 years in state jail and/or a fine up to $10,000 |
DIY Disposal Option 1: City and County Public Facilities
For residents willing to handle the hauling themselves, the city and county offer several facilities designed for specific types of waste.
Austin’s Recycle & Reuse Drop-off Center
This is the city’s primary hub for items that can’t go in your regular curbside bins, especially household hazardous waste (HHW) and electronics.
- Address: 2514 Business Center Drive, Austin, TX 78744.
- How it Works: This facility is by appointment only. Austin and Travis County residents can schedule a drop-off time online through the city’s website.
- Cost: Free for Austin and Travis County residents (except for a small fee for tires).
- Accepted Items: This is the go-to spot for HHW (paint, cleaners, automotive fluids, batteries), electronics (computers, TVs, cell phones), appliances (microwaves, washers, dryers), and other hard-to-recycle materials like Styrofoam and plastic film.
- The Catch: You must plan ahead. The appointment system means you can’t just show up when you feel like it, which can be a challenge for spontaneous cleanout projects.
Travis County 1431 Citizens Collection Center
Located in Cedar Park, this facility is an option for residents in the northern part of the county for basic household trash.
- Address: 2625 Woodall Dr., Cedar Park, TX 78613.
- Hours: Limited to Thursday–Saturday, 8:00 am–3:50 pm.
- Cost: Charges a fee per cubic yard (roughly a pickup truck bed). They only accept cash or check.
- Limitations: This center is for household trash only. It does not accept business waste, HHW, appliances, large furniture, or mattresses.
DIY Disposal Option 2: Private Landfills and Transfer Stations
For large volumes of general trash, construction debris, or bulky items not accepted at public centers, a private landfill is your next option. These facilities are built for commercial haulers but are open to the public, though they come with their own set of rules and costs.
Austin Community Landfill (WM)
- Address: 9900 Giles Road, Austin, TX 78754.
- Hours for Public: Monday–Friday from 7 a.m. to 4 p.m. for “hand-unload” customers; Saturday from 7 a.m. to 12 p.m..
- Requirements: All customers are required to wear a safety vest. You can bring your own or purchase one on-site. Disposal fees vary based on the load, so it’s best to call ahead for an estimate.
Travis County Landfill (Waste Connections)
- Address: 9600 FM 812, Austin, TX 78719.
- Hours for Public: Monday–Friday from 7:00 AM to 4:30 PM; Saturday from 7:00 AM to 12:00 PM.
- Requirements: Safety is strict here. All customers must wear hard hats, safety vests, and safety glasses. There are minimum load fees (often starting around 2 tons), which can make disposing of just a few items very expensive. They also charge extra for items like mattresses and tires.
Texas Disposal Systems (TDS) Landfill
- Address: 3016 FM 1327, Creedmoor, TX 78610.
- Hours for Public: Monday–Saturday from 7:00 a.m. to sunset.
- Details: TDS operates a “Citizens Convenience Center” designed for public drop-offs. However, expect a minimum drop-off fee (around $66 for a standard pickup truck load) plus additional surcharges for specific items like mattresses, box springs, and sofas (often $25 each).
